2012-07-12 2 views
0

Мне нужно проверить, содержит ли первая ячейка в первом столбце символы «ND». Ячейка может содержать «Rm ####» или «Rm #### ND» ». если ячейка содержит символы «ND», тогда изображение в форме должно быть видимым.проверить значение ячейки из поиска datatable

это код, который я использую в настоящее время для поиска базы данных доступа ... Результаты поиска всегда возвращают только одну строку данных из данных. Есть ли способ, который я могу включить в поиск?

Try 
     Dim con As New OleDbConnection("Provider=Microsoft.ACE.OLEDB.12.0;Data Source='\\SERVER\Drawings\Database\Drawing Database.accdb'") 
     con.Open() 
     Me.DrawingsTableAdapter.DrawingNumber2(Me.Drawing_DatabaseDataSet.Drawings, ("%" & TextBox2.Text & "%")) 
     Me.Validate() 
     Me.TableAdapterManager.UpdateAll(Me.Drawing_DatabaseDataSet) 
     con.Close() 
    Catch ex As System.Exception 
     System.Windows.Forms.MessageBox.Show(ex.Message) 
+0

Что такое SQL для DrawingsTableAdapter SelectCommand? –

ответ

0

может быть, вы потеряли одиночные кавычки
"% '& TextBox2.Text & "' %"
посмотреть, работает ли он

к тому же, я никогда не видел функцию ' DrawingNumber2 '
и не найден в Интернете.
Слишком много самоопределяемого кода, не так понятный.

Смежные вопросы